Staffing Operations Manager

  • Location: Midland, TX
  • Position Type: Full-time
Overview

We are seeking an experienced Staffing Operations Manager to lead and establish our new office presence in Midland, TX. In this role, you will oversee day-to-day office operations, drive account alignment, enforce compliance, and serve as the primary operational liaison to central onboarding, contractor success, safety and compliance teams.

Responsibilities
  • Operations Management: Oversee daily operations including administration, financial/timekeeping workflows, account alignment, and overall operational efficiency to support growth targets.
  • Client & Contractor Relations: Build strong relationships with client stakeholders. Handle account escalations, client feedback, contract adherence, and overall service delivery satisfaction.
  • Safety & HSE Compliance: Serve as the primary point of contact for client HSE directors and safety personnel. Ensure all assigned contractors maintain full compliance with ISNetworld, fit-for-duty standards, and DISA background screenings prior to placement.
  • Audit &

    Risk Management:

    Monitor contractor documentation, client price books, and compliance to ensure full alignment with Master Service Agreements (MSAs) and safety regulations.
  • Incident Management: Coordinate workplace incident intake, post-accident drug testing protocols, and client reporting in alignment with corporate safety standards and OSHA requirements.
Required Qualifications
  • 5+ years of progressive operational leadership experience within the oilfield staffing industry.
  • Strong working knowledge of commercial staffing operations, client contract management, and safety compliance.
  • Proven ability to launch and manage office operations independently in a fast-paced market.
  • Deep knowledge of Permian Basin vendor compliance platforms (ISNetworld, PEC Premier, DISA, Veriforce).
